im即时通讯软件的跨区域通话质量如何?

随着互联网技术的飞速发展,即时通讯软件已经成为人们日常生活中不可或缺的一部分。其中,im即时通讯软件凭借其强大的功能和便捷的操作,深受广大用户的喜爱。然而,在使用过程中,许多用户都对im即时通讯软件的跨区域通话质量产生了疑问。本文将从多个角度对im即时通讯软件的跨区域通话质量进行分析,帮助用户了解该软件的通话效果。

一、im即时通讯软件的跨区域通话技术

  1. 网络协议

im即时通讯软件的跨区域通话质量与其采用的网络协议有很大关系。目前,im即时通讯软件主要采用以下几种网络协议:

(1)TCP/IP协议:该协议是目前互联网通信的基础,具有可靠性高、传输速度快等特点。

(2)UDP协议:与TCP/IP协议相比,UDP协议传输速度快,但可靠性较低。im即时通讯软件在保证通话质量的前提下,适当采用UDP协议可以提高通话速度。

(3)RTCP协议:实时传输控制协议,用于监控实时传输的质量,如丢包率、延迟等。


  1. 压缩算法

im即时通讯软件在传输音频信号时,会采用压缩算法降低数据传输量,提高通话质量。常见的压缩算法有:

(1)G.711:该算法适用于低码率、高音质的需求,如电话通话。

(2)G.729:该算法适用于中低码率、高音质的需求,如视频通话。

(3)OPUS:该算法是目前最先进的音频压缩算法,适用于各种码率和音质需求。


  1. 服务器架构

im即时通讯软件的跨区域通话质量还与其服务器架构有关。优秀的服务器架构可以降低延迟、提高通话质量。目前,im即时通讯软件主要采用以下几种服务器架构:

(1)中心化架构:所有用户的数据都存储在中心服务器上,便于管理和维护。

(2)分布式架构:将用户数据分散存储在多个服务器上,提高数据传输速度和可靠性。

二、im即时通讯软件的跨区域通话质量分析

  1. 网络稳定性

im即时通讯软件的跨区域通话质量受网络稳定性影响较大。在网络环境较差的地区,通话可能会出现断断续续、音质差等问题。为了提高通话质量,im即时通讯软件会采取以下措施:

(1)自动切换网络:当检测到当前网络环境较差时,自动切换到更稳定的网络。

(2)网络优化:通过优化网络传输算法,降低网络延迟和丢包率。


  1. 通话延迟

通话延迟是影响im即时通讯软件跨区域通话质量的重要因素。以下是影响通话延迟的因素及应对措施:

(1)服务器距离:服务器距离较远会导致通话延迟增加。im即时通讯软件会通过优化服务器架构,缩短服务器距离,降低通话延迟。

(2)网络拥塞:网络拥塞会导致数据传输速度变慢,从而增加通话延迟。im即时通讯软件会采取以下措施降低网络拥塞:

a. 优先级传输:将通话数据设置为高优先级,确保数据传输速度。

b. 数据压缩:采用高效的数据压缩算法,降低数据传输量。


  1. 音质效果

im即时通讯软件的音质效果与其采用的压缩算法、解码算法等因素有关。以下是影响音质效果的因素及应对措施:

(1)压缩算法:采用高效的压缩算法可以降低数据传输量,提高音质效果。

(2)解码算法:解码算法的优化可以提高音质效果。

(3)抗噪技术:采用抗噪技术可以有效降低通话过程中的噪音干扰,提高音质效果。

三、总结

im即时通讯软件的跨区域通话质量与其采用的通信技术、服务器架构、网络环境等因素密切相关。虽然存在一些影响因素,但im即时通讯软件在不断提升自身技术,努力提高跨区域通话质量。用户在选择im即时通讯软件时,可以根据自己的需求和网络环境,选择合适的软件,享受优质的跨区域通话体验。

猜你喜欢:短信验证码平台